PBT status:
the substance is not PBT / vPvB
Justification:

The PBT properties were assessed according to the screening criteria laid down in the ECHA Guidance on information requirements and chemical safety assessment Chapter R.11: PBT Assessment (2017).

One key study is available (Desmares-Koopmans, 2017) where the ready biodegradability of the substance was determined according to OECD 301 B (Klimisch score of 1). The relative biodegradation values calculated from the measurements performed during the text period relealed 6% and 23% biodegradation of the test item based on ThCO2, for the duplicate bottles tested. The criterion for ready biodegradability was not met (at least 60% biodegration within a 10-day window).

According to the screening criteria laid down in the ECHA Guidance on information requirements and chemical safety assessment Chapter R.11: PBT Assessment (2017), a biodegradation of <60% measured as ThCO2 according to OECD 301 B indicates that substance is potentially P or vP.

The bioaccumulation assessment is based on the screening criteria in Annex XIII of the REACH Regulation. A measured Log Kow of 5.5 at pH 7 has been determined in an OECD 117 study (Reingruber, 2017).

No full bioaccumulation test with T003066 is available but the estimated BCF value (using the measured log Kow value of 5.5) is 1977 L/kg ww (BCFBAF v3.01 program; Estimation Programs Interface Suite™ for Microsoft® Windows v 4.11., US EPA), which indicates that the substance does not fulfill the screening criteria in Annex XIII of the REACH Regulation for bioaccumulation assessment (BCF > 2000 L/kg ww) but the predicted value is close to the cut-off value.

Since the measured log Kow of the parent compound is above the criterium of log Kow > 4.5 and the predicted BCF value is close to the cut-off value of 2000 L/kg, the test substance is considered potentially B.

Chronic toxicity data are available for algae only. Due to the very low solubility of T003066, concentration levels that might be toxic for algae could not be reached and no effects on growth rate and yield were seen in 100% of a saturated solution prepared at a loading rate of 100 mg/L. In addition, the substance is not classified as carcinogenic (category 1A or 1B), germ cell mutagenic (category 1A or 1B), or toxic for reproduction (category 1A, 1B or 2) according to the CLP Regulation and the substance is not classified for specific target organ toxicity after repeated exposure (STOT RE category 1 or 2) according to the CLP Regulation. Therefore the substance can be concluded not to fulfil the criteria for "T".

Taking into account all available data, it can be concluded that the substance is not PBT/vPvB.
